Why Withdrawals Matter More Than Deposits

Nothing reveals a casino’s true character like withdrawal requests. Depositing money? Instant, seamless, encouraged. Getting your winnings back? That’s when you discover what the platform actually thinks of you.

I’ve waited weeks for payouts at some sites. Watched my withdrawal “pending” for days with zero communication. Submitted verification documents three times because they kept “losing” them. These experiences poison everything—even previous wins feel tainted when you’re fighting to access your own money.

Compare that to platforms where withdrawals process within hours. Where verification happens once and stays verified. Where your money moves as easily out as it moved in.

Transparency Beats Generosity

Casinos love advertising massive bonuses. “500% match! 1000 free spins! Unlimited cashback!” The numbers sound incredible until you read the terms.

I’ve claimed “generous” bonuses with 60x wagering requirements that made withdrawal mathematically impossible. Received “free” spins capped at €0.10 each with €20 maximum cashout. These offers aren’t generous—they’re marketing theater.

What players actually appreciate? Honest terms. Reasonable wagering. Clear explanations of what you’re agreeing to. A 50% bonus with 25x playthrough delivers more real value than a 200% bonus with 50x requirements. But only transparent casinos will tell you that.

The platforms earning loyalty don’t necessarily offer the biggest numbers. They offer the clearest communication about what those numbers actually mean.

Support That Solves Problems

Ever contacted casino support with a real issue? The experience ranges from genuinely helpful to kafkaesque nightmare. Some platforms employ knowledgeable agents who resolve problems in minutes. Others route you through scripted responses that address nothing you actually asked.

Good support isn’t just available—it’s competent. The agent understands your problem, has authority to fix it, and follows through. Bad support creates tickets that vanish, promises callbacks that never come, and treats every player concern as potential fraud.
